Blood Pressure Systolic pressure is the pressure at which the blood leaves the heart through the aorta. Diastolic pressure is the minimum blood pressure in the aorta. Blood pressure can be measured with a sphygmomanometer: first reading is systolic and second is diastolic then represented as a fraction.
